The story of J’aime was one of great pain. This little baby rhino was tragically stabbed by poachers in the wild, after losing her mother, but thankfully, she was rescued and rehabilitated at The Rhino Orphanage. Now, with her injuries healed and the past hopefully far behind her, little J’aime is exploring the many simple joys of being a little rhino – one of them definitely being big puddles!
J’aime was beyond excited to explore this new pastime. She even put her nose right into the water and started blowing bubbles, which, as her caretakers report, is something she absolutely loves to do. It is safe to say that mud wallowing is going to be one of her new favorite things!
